Mounted Kinematic Mirror Holder "MB-25M"

By using the pivot of the kinematic mechanism as a reference, it can be adapted to a pole type by removing the mounting plate.

The mounted kinematic mirror holder "MB-25M" is based on a pivot point due to its kinematic mechanism. By removing the mounting plate, it can also accommodate pole types. The mirror element is fixed using a Delrin ring and a screw ring. When using the purchased holder with elements of different outer diameters, it is possible to accommodate this with an adapter mount. The fine adjustment method is a micrometer head type, and the element diameter is 25mm. The material is aluminum, and it is surface-treated with black anodizing. Kinematic Mirror Holder "MC-10"

It has a compact shape and is also effective for use as a beam splitter.

The Kinematic Mirror Holder "MC-10" is based on a pivot point due to its kinematic mechanism. It has a compact shape and is also effective for use as a beam splitter. The mirror element is secured from the side using a resin-tipped screw. In addition to the standard pole type, it also supports installation types with an incident angle of 0 degrees and 45 degrees, with a beam height of 30mm or more. The standard specification includes a diameter 12L=60 pole, which can be changed between L=20 and 120. For more details, please download the catalog.
